Sew together 36 of these 10 degree triangles to create a complete circle; 18 to create a half-circle; or 9 to create a quarter-circle. Create Fans, Dresden Plates, etc. up to a finished size of 31 1/2". Total ruler length is 16".

Wedges make circles, but Squedges make squares. The 11.5 degree Squedge makes a 16" finished square (16-1/2" with seam allowances) with 32 Squedge pieces. Use the precise slots for marking the inner shorter pieces. A bonus pattern is included with the ruler.
